Positive Commitment


We have lived in Madison since 1975 and can honestly say in our opinion that no other couple has given more to our town than Tom and Eileen Banisch.

Their involvement in many of our town’s community organizations, youth sports, the Rotary Club, town government, the Chamber of Commerce, St. Margaret Church, and more demonstrate their wide variety of positive commitment to our town.

Tom, in his two terms as first selectman, worked tirelessly on many initiatives, integrating with other Connecticut towns to influence Hartford decisions so as to benefit our state’s small towns.

Eileen, in her executive director position at the Chamber of Commerce, has always had a positive and creative way with our many small businesses to promote Madison.

So many Madison residents can call them both friends. Tom and Eileen leaving will also leave an empty feeling felt for some time by many. Our hearts go out to them both and wish them many blessings in their new home.

Mike and Connie Piccione

Madison
